study guides for every class

that actually explain what's on your next test

Buchberger's Algorithm

from class:

Computational Algebraic Geometry

Definition

Buchberger's Algorithm is a method for computing Gröbner bases of polynomial ideals, which are crucial in solving systems of polynomial equations. This algorithm not only provides a systematic approach to finding these bases but also ensures that the results can be used in various applications like elimination theory and symbolic computation, aiding in understanding the structure and properties of polynomial systems.

congrats on reading the definition of Buchberger's Algorithm.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Buchberger's Algorithm was introduced by Bruno Buchberger in 1965 and is fundamental in computational algebraic geometry.
  2. The algorithm works by iteratively taking pairs of polynomials and reducing their S-polynomial until a set of generators is found that satisfies certain properties.
  3. Gröbner bases computed through Buchberger's Algorithm are unique up to a choice of monomial ordering, highlighting their importance in determining the structure of ideals.
  4. The algorithm can be generalized to work with different kinds of monomial orderings, which influences the resulting Gröbner bases.
  5. Applications of Buchberger's Algorithm extend to various fields, including robotics, coding theory, and computer-aided geometric design.

Review Questions

  • How does Buchberger's Algorithm contribute to solving polynomial systems?
    • Buchberger's Algorithm simplifies the process of finding Gröbner bases, which in turn makes solving polynomial systems more manageable. By transforming the original system into a simpler equivalent system with a well-defined structure, it enables easier manipulation and analysis. The use of Gröbner bases allows one to effectively eliminate variables, leading to clearer paths toward solutions or insights into the nature of the solutions.
  • Discuss the significance of monomial orderings in Buchberger's Algorithm and their impact on the uniqueness of Gröbner bases.
    • Monomial orderings play a crucial role in Buchberger's Algorithm as they determine how polynomials are processed during the computation of Gröbner bases. Different orderings can lead to different Gröbner bases for the same ideal, showcasing that while these bases are unique up to ordering, the choice of ordering significantly affects computational efficiency and outcomes. Understanding this impact is essential for applying Buchberger’s Algorithm effectively in practical scenarios.
  • Evaluate how Buchberger's Algorithm has influenced modern computational methods in algebraic geometry and related fields.
    • Buchberger's Algorithm has profoundly influenced modern computational methods by providing a foundational framework for handling polynomial equations systematically. Its introduction allowed researchers to develop software tools that automate computations involving Gröbner bases, making complex problems more tractable across various applications, such as robotics and coding theory. This algorithm not only improved theoretical insights into algebraic structures but also led to practical advancements in problem-solving techniques within computational algebraic geometry.

"Buchberger's Algorithm" also found in:

© 2025 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ides